Handover: Timezone Handling in Report Exports

Hey — passing the Lanternfield export pipeline to you. Quick summary for the security review: all timestamps are stored UTC, converted at render time using the viewer's profile zone. The gnarly bit is DST boundaries in scheduled exports; see the Driftwell shim. Nothing user-controlled touches the tz database path, which matters for the review. If you need to restore the signing keystore, use the recovery passphrase just below.

vault phrase of tajef-tafog = istox-sorax-zorox-casok-holox-kelix-weneth-drueth-casion

Subject: Tax cache hotfix shipped

Team — hotfix for the Penwright tax-rate lookup cache is out. The cache now invalidates on every rate-table publish instead of the hourly sweep, which was the root cause of the stale Marbury-region rates last week. No schema changes, no config changes. Maintainers: if you need to verify deployment, the identifier for this release is noted below.

build token for kagaf-hahof: htk14_9d3d4d26d7d8de

## Ownership

Heads up, reviewer: the monthly partitioning logic in `partitions/rotate.sql` is a bit fiddly. Quartermoth rotates the `events` table on the first of each month, and the cutover script assumes UTC boundaries — don't "fix" that, it's intentional. If a partition looks missing, check the rotation job before touching anything by hand. All changes here need sign-off from the partitioning owner listed below.

account owner for tawef-yadug: Jorius Normir Silath

### Hot-reload gone sideways?

If Cobbleton picks up a bad config on reload, it keeps serving with the last good one — so don't panic. Check the reload log for a rejected revision, fix the typo, and reload again. The step-by-step recovery guide lives on our internal page.

wiki page, tahaf-tajog: https://jira.ordindyn.corp/pipeline

Visitor policy — night shift: Support team members at Corvale Place may admit pre-registered visitors only between 22:00 and 06:00. All visitors sign the night log and remain escorted. Unregistered arrivals wait in the lobby until the duty lead approves. Entry to the support wing requires the code below.

door code, yagap-bahof: bdg-O-05